What's up, Osiris? My name is Ambroscus Koth, you may know me better as your root administrator and co-founder of this very region. Since the days of the KRO I've been lurking about, helping the region when I can and generally maintaining structure. I come before you today to run for Pharaoh of Osiris once more, to bring this region back from the snoozefest it's been lately.
Will I be successful in that? Well, it's up to all of us as a region to make that happen.
I haven't exactly been a paragon of activity in this region, that's for sure. Life's been nuts, lots of family trouble and college shit, trying to find a job, whatever. But I'm here now, and if you guys throw me into the seat I can promise I'll try to bring the OFO to the heights I envisioned during its inception.
Much like literally every other GCR, we have a goldmine of potential activity sitting right under our noses, in our region and on our RMB. We need to recruit our regionmates to the forum as much as we can, get them active in our revitalized activities. They're important, folks like them are what eventually ends up fueling Gameplay. Lord knows I used to just be some RMB-dwelling shmuck until I registered on my first regional forum. Taking that first step is often the introduction of an active player to our community. We need to make it happen. Getting people on the forum and KEEPING them on the forum is a top priority for me, because if we can make that happen, everything else on my platform becomes significantly easier as well as makes the region more and more of the awesome fraternal order I had in mind when I co-founded the government.
The roleplay section of this region has always been a problem child. Shit's hard as hell to get on its feet, but I'm gonna try jump starting it again and see if it can take off again. From my experience in this region's drunk dad, the Brotherhood of Malice, I can tell you that an active RP is an active region. I'll also be trying my best to spend my fair share of time in the spam section, because if we're being real, that shit is a huge part of endearing people to the region. If we can get roleplay rolling again, along with a fast paced spam section, we're partway to a better Osiris already.
As the delegate, I'd have primary responsibility over the gameside region. This means that to keep the region of Osiris entertained, I'll be throwing up constant polls, apparently that's the new fun thing to do. Even if they're retarded, people still eat that shit up. Against my best wishes, I'll also be tasked with keeping the RMB active and clean of any dipshits who think that we really wanna hear their explanation of why Hitler did nothing wrong or whatever. Yeah...not in my Osiris, buddy. I can't be awake 24/7, so I'll be appointing some folks in at least an unofficial capacity to help me weed out gameside troublemakers.
Something to note is that we don't have a Scribe of Foreign Affairs, which is really not good. We need to reinvigorate our FA, especially after a period of low activity. Maintaining relations with our allies is important to keeping our region relevant in the eyes of our friends, and by proxy the rest of the game.
Culture is a roller coaster in this region. Sometimes it's great, sometimes it's dead. Osiris is a region with a lot to celebrate, and I think it's important to ensure a return to the days of routine cultural festivals and fun games. Perhaps we can even get a Minecraft server or something up like we used to have. Something to bring us together again.
The one thing that most people know me for is my military career in NationStates. It's my primary focus, and I daresay I'm good at it. I know the ins and outs of the R/D game, and I'll be putting it to use ensuring the continuation of a smoothly running Sekhmet Legion. Trust me when I say that there's a LOT of potential in raiding, and making sure that we're a feared military power makes us not only safer from people who wish to subvert our great region, but also help us appear useful to our allies in their time of need. I've got the know-how, all we need is the can-do from soldiers. An active GCR military is no laughing matter, we can see success in the form of the EPSA, which has greatly expanded the capabilities of The East Pacific. That's a model I want to follow.
This is a pretty fucking ambitious platform, especially coming from me, but I feel like we can accomplish these goals over the course of my term. This is your chance, Osiris, to help me accomplish the vision I had for this region when Venico and Cormac were at my side shaping this region from the ashes of the KRO. We've been content to settle for mediocrity lately, and I seriously don't blame us. It's easy to sit back and take the game in stride, lord knows I've done it plenty of times. But there comes a time when we as a region have to say that we aren't satisfied with what we've been accomplishing in the past, and move to a brighter future. Now listen, I've done a fuckload of writing tonight and quite honestly I'm sick of words. It's time for action. I'm all about action. With your votes, Osiris, we will move forward to put my plan into action.
Let's go.
